1. Understand the Exam Pattern

IMU CET consists of multiple-choice questions covering subjects like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, English, General Knowledge, and Aptitude. Familiarize yourself with the exam pattern and syllabus to know what to expect.

Suggested Books for IMU CET Exam Preparation

  • Physics:
    • 1. “Concepts of Physics” by H.C. Verma
    • 2. “Understanding Physics” by D.C. Pandey
  • Chemistry:
    • 1. “Organic Chemistry” by O.P. Tandon
    • 2. “Physical Chemistry” by P. Bahadur
  • Mathematics:
    • 1. “Higher Algebra” by Hall and Knight
    • 2. “Differential Calculus” by Amit M. Agarwal
  • English:
    • 1. “Word Power Made Easy” by Norman Lewis
    • 2. “High School English Grammar and Composition” by Wren and Martin
  • General Knowledge:
    • 1. “Manorama Yearbook” by Mammen Mathew
    • 2. “Lucent’s General Knowledge” by Dr. Binay Karna
  • Aptitude:
    • 1. “Quantitative Aptitude for Competitive Examinations” by R.S. Aggarwal
    • 2. “A Modern Approach to Verbal & Non-Verbal Reasoning” by R.S. Aggarwal

These books cover the essential subjects and topics for IMU CET exam preparation. Be sure to check the latest editions for updated content and practice questions. Happy studying!

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about IMU CET

1. What is IMU CET?

IMU CET stands for Indian Maritime University Common Entrance Test. It is an entrance exam conducted by the Indian Maritime University for admission to various undergraduate and postgraduate programs in the maritime field.

2. When is IMU CET conducted?

IMU CET is usually conducted in the month of June each year for undergraduate programs and in December for postgraduate programs. However, specific dates may vary, so check the official website for the latest updates.

3. What are the eligibility criteria for IMU CET?

Eligibility criteria vary depending on the course. Generally, candidates must have passed 10+2 with a minimum percentage and specific subjects for undergraduate courses. For postgraduate courses, a relevant bachelor’s degree is required. Refer to the official notification for detailed eligibility criteria.

4. How can I apply for IMU CET?

You can apply for IMU CET online by visiting the official website of the Indian Maritime University. Fill out the application form, upload required documents, and pay the application fee online.

5. What is the exam pattern for IMU CET?

The exam pattern includes multiple-choice questions covering subjects like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English, General Knowledge, and Aptitude. The number of questions and time duration may vary based on the course you’re applying for.

6. Is there negative marking in IMU CET?

Yes, there is negative marking in IMU CET. For each incorrect answer, a certain number of marks is deducted, so it’s important to answer accurately.

7. Can I get previous years’ question papers for IMU CET?

Yes, previous years’ question papers are available online and in preparation books. Solving these papers can help you understand the exam pattern and practice effectively.
